Where can I find a reliable Volvo repair shop in or near La Grande, Washington?

Given La Grande's small size, you will likely need to look in nearby larger communities like Centralia or Chehalis for specialized Volvo service. Seek shops that are Volvo-specific or European auto specialists, and check reviews from local drivers in Lewis County for trusted recommendations.

What are common Volvo repair issues for drivers in the La Grande area?

The local climate with damp, cool weather can accelerate wear on electrical components, battery life, and brake systems due to moisture. Volvos in this region also commonly need attention for aging suspension components, given the mix of rural roads and highway driving to reach larger towns.

How do I know when my Volvo needs immediate service from a local mechanic?

Seek immediate service for dashboard warning lights like the check engine or SRS airbag light, unusual noises from the AWD system on forest service roads, or overheating, especially before traveling on Highway 12. For less urgent issues, schedule a diagnostic check at a shop in Centralia.

Are Volvo repairs more expensive in the La Grande area compared to larger cities?

While labor rates may be slightly lower than in major metros, parts availability can cause delays and potentially higher costs, as specialized components often need to be ordered. Building a relationship with a local Lewis County shop that sources parts efficiently is key to managing costs.

What local driving conditions should I consider for maintaining my Volvo near La Grande?

The rural terrain and gravel forest service roads can be hard on tires, alignment, and undercarriage protection. It's advisable to have your suspension and tire integrity checked regularly, and ensure your Volvo's all-wheel-drive system is serviced to handle wet, unpaved roads common in the area.
